Gutter sealing services involve applying specialized materials to the seams and joints of a property's gutter system to prevent leaks and water infiltration. This process typically includes inspecting the existing gutters for damage or vulnerabilities, cleaning out debris, and then sealing any gaps or cracks with durable sealants. The goal is to create a watertight barrier that ensures rainwater flows properly through the gutters and downspouts, reducing the risk of water damage to the property's foundation, walls, and roof.
One of the primary issues gutter sealing addresses is water leakage, which can lead to significant structural problems if left untreated. Leaking gutters may cause water to spill over the sides, pooling around the foundation or seeping into the building's interior. Over time, this can result in foundation erosion, mold growth, and damage to siding or interior walls. Gutter sealing helps mitigate these problems by maintaining the integrity of the gutter system, ensuring that water is directed away from the property efficiently and effectively.

Basic Gutter Sealing - The cost for sealing gutters typically ranges from $150 to $300 for standard homes. Prices depend on the length of gutters and the extent of sealing needed, with example costs around $200 for a 150-foot home. Local pros may charge more for complex or larger properties.
Premium Gutter Sealing - Higher-end sealing services can cost between $300 and $600, especially for larger or multi-story homes. These services often include additional protective coatings or advanced sealants, with some projects reaching $500 or more.
Material Costs - The price of sealant materials varies, with basic silicone or polyurethane sealants costing around $10 to $20 per tube. Professional services often include material costs in the overall price, but DIY options may require purchasing multiple tubes depending on gutter length.
Additional Service Fees - Some contractors may charge extra for cleaning gutters prior to sealing, typically adding $50 to $150. Costs can also increase if repairs or extensive preparation are needed before sealing can be performed effectively.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is gutter sealing? Gutter sealing involves applying a protective material to the seams and joints of gutters to prevent leaks and water damage.
Why should I consider gutter sealing services? Gutter sealing can help prevent water from leaking or overflowing, reducing the risk of damage to your home's foundation and landscaping.
How often should gutters be sealed? The frequency of sealing depends on the condition of existing gutters, but typically, sealing may be needed every few years or when signs of leaks appear.
What types of materials are used for gutter sealing? Common materials include sealants like silicone or polyurethane that provide durable, waterproof protection for gutter joints.
